Estrutura eletrônica de fios quânticos gerados por distribuição de carga espacial / Electronic structure of quantum wires by spatial charge distribution

Alexandre Marletta 07 March 1997 (has links)
Neste trabalho investigamos a estrutura eletrônica de fios quânticos formados por distribuição de carga espacial, obtidos a partir da incorporação de dopantes nos degraus que delimitam planos vicinais em semicondutores. Estudos experimentais recentes, que combinam o crescimento epitaxial em planos vicinais (terraços) sobre o GaAs com as técnica de dopagem planar abrupta, sugerem que a incorporação do dopante (Silício) ocorre preferencialmente ao longo das linhas que delimitam os planos vicinais deste semicondutor. Baseados em resultados teóricos recentes, que sugerem que a aproximação semiclássica de Thomas-Fermi é capaz de reproduzir o potencial auto-consciente de sistemas eletrônicos criados a partir de distribuições de carga de origem puramente espacial, vários efeitos tais como: difusão de dopantes, temperatura finita e densidade residual de aceitadores puderam ser investigados neste nível de aproximação. As equações de Kohn-Sham na aproximação de densidade local (T=0K) foram também empregadas com o propósito de avaliar-se a possível influência de efeitos de não localidade do funcional energia cinética e efeitos de muitos corpos (troca e correlação) que foram ignorados pela abordagem semiclássica. / In this work we investigate the electronic structure of space-charge quantum wires obtained via attachment of donors in misorientation steps of semiconductor vicinal surfaces. Recent experimental studies, combining epitaxial growth on GaAs (100) vicinal surfaces (terraces) with the ?-doping technique, suggests that the incorporation of Silicon donors is preferential along the lines that delimit the vicinal terraces in this semiconductor. Based on recent theoretical results suggesting that the Thomas-Fermi is a reliable approximation for the self-consistent potential fo space-charge layers, we have employed this approximation to study the possible influence of various factors such as diffusion of dopants, finite temperature and residual density of acceptors on the electronic structure of these wires. The Kohn-Sham equations, within the local density approximation (T=0K), were also solved as the propose of evaluating the influence of effects due to the non-locality of the kinectic energy densities functional and many body effects (exchange and correlation) that were ignored in the semiclassical approximation.

Desenvolvimento de laminador para confecção de fios ortodônticos retangulares e suas caracterizações / Development of rolling mill for rectangular orthodontic wires production and its characterization

Gouvêa, Carlos Alberto Rodrigues de 25 March 2008 (has links)
Nos tratamentos ortodônticos, fios de diferentes ligas metálicas são utilizados nas etapas de alinhamento, nivelamento, correção da posição molar, fechamento espacial, acabamento e retenção. Com relação às duas últimas, responsáveis pelo posicionamento adequado dos dentes superiores sobre os inferiores, a preparação requer um fio que favoreça o torque de incisão, ou seja, que apresente grande resistência e rigidez associadas à ativação de pequeno alcance. Para este fim, os fios de aços inoxidáveis austeníticos retangulares são os preferidos em razão do módulo de elasticidade elevado e boa resistência à corrosão no meio bucal. Quanto à geometria retangular, o processo de fabricação requer desenvolvimento tecnológico adequado para a produção em escala industrial de fios com as características geométricas e propriedades mecânicas para melhor adequação às necessidades de uso. Com o objetivo de se produzir fios com tais características, foi desenvolvido um laminador para a fabricação de fios retangulares com a intuito de se dispor de uma alternativa de menor custo ao processo de produção por trefilação, de custo elevado, devido a complexidade das matrizes. Além da fabricação do laminador, foram avaliados os aspectos tecnológicos que envolveram os efeitos da deformação nas propriedades mecânicas dos fios, por meio de medidas de microdurezas e ensaios em tração e de flexão. Nos testes realizados, os fios apresentaram geometria, acabamento superficial e propriedades mecânicas adequadas à sua utilização em tratamentos ortodônticos. / In orthodontic treatments, wires of different metallic alloys are used for alignment, leveling, correction of the molar position, space closing, finish and retention. With respect to finish and retention, these wires are responsible for adequate positioning of the upper teeth on the lower teeth. Wires that are subjected to incisor torque require high resistance and stiffness. For this, wires of rectangular austenitic stainless steel are used due to high modulus of elasticity and good corrosion resistance in the oral environment. Because of the rectangular geometry, wire production requires process development suitable for industrial scale manufacture with geometric characteristics and mechanical properties better adapted to the use conditions. To obtain wires with such characteristics, a rolling mill was developed for the production of rectangular wires by a rolling process with the objective of reducing cost of the cold drawing process that is currently used, which utilize complex and expensive wiredrawing dies. In addition to the rolling process itself, wire deformation, microhardness, tension and bend tests were also performed. In these tests, wire geometry, surface finish and mechanical properties were successfully adapted for use in orthodontic treatments.

Growth of Boron-doped Diamond Films on Porous Silicon by Microwave Plasma Chemical Vapor Deposition

Chuang, Yao-Li 27 June 2003 (has links)
Synthetic diamond thin films have potential for fabricating high-temperature semiconducting and optical devices because of its extraordinary properties. In this work, a microwave plasma chemical vapor deposition system has been setup. A two-steps deposition process will be applied for the growth of boron-doped diamond on silicon and on porous silicon. The effects of temperature, microwave power and of doping concentration of B2O3 have been studied by varying the growth parameters. The doping source of B2O3 solved in C2H5OH is applied with carrying gas of Ar. To vary the concentration of boron with the flow of Ar is controlled mixing into a reaction gas of CH4 and H2 mixture. Polycrystalline diamond thin films are examined by Raman, XRD and FTIR. In the SEM photograph a nano-wires structure has been found for higher doping of B2O3. A higher temperature the growth rate of the boron-doped diamond films will increase and the shape of crystallites will tend to polycrystalline. The diamond growth is in multi steps and the mechanism of deposition will change when the boron-doped diamond film grows up to a critical thickness. In this work a smooth diamond film was successfully grown on porous silicon without the step of nucleation.

Synthesis, Structure, and Reactivity of New Palladium(III) Complexes

Campbell, Michael Glenn 06 June 2014 (has links)
Palladium is one of the most common and versatile transition metals used in modern organometallic chemistry. The chemistry of palladium in its 0, +II, and +IV oxidation states is well-known; by comparison, the chemistry of palladium in its +III oxidation state is in its infancy. The work in this thesis involves the study of previously unknown Pd(III) complexes, including applications in materials chemistry and catalysis. / Chemistry and Chemical Biology
